Pietro Fabris, master of the 18th century
Pietro Fabris, an Italian painter and engraver active in the 18th century, became known for his documentary compositions and portraits for Grand Tour patrons. A collaborator of diplomats and an admirer of Neapolitan scenes, Fabris blends realism with an eye for detail—an inheritance of the artistic practices of his time. His approach combines topographical rigor with a sense of storytelling, offering here a portrait of great psychological presence. Influenced by late Baroque traditions and the demands of aristocratic portraiture, he signs a work in which the precision of the features meets chromatic warmth, making this painting both historical and timeless.
